1. A T.E.N.S. electrode comprising:
- an essentially dry, body-conformable, electrically-conductive interfacing layer having an adherent top surface and a lower body-contacting surface adherent to the skin, said interfacing layer being extensible up to 50 percent in a manner similar to human skin;
a backing member attached to said top surface of said interfacing layer, said backing member having a hole therethrough providing access to said interfacing layer for electrical contact, said backing member exhibiting sufficient extensibility to be compliant with said interfacing layer after the electrode is placed on the wearer; and
a body-conformable, one-piece electrically-conductive connector having a substantially flat electrical impulse distribution portion releasably adhered in electrical contact with said top surface of said interfacing layer through said hole of said backing member in electrical contact with said interfacing layer and an upper surface having therein a means for releasable connection to a connector lead of an electrical stimulator.

Abstract
A T.E.N.S. electrode is disclosed comprising an essentially dry, body-conformable, electrically-conductive interfacing layer having a maximum thickness of 10 mils, a low profile, one-piece electrically-conductive connector adherent to the top surface of the interfacing layer and a backing member, overlying the interfacing layer and the connector. The electrode is extensible in at least one direction up to 50 percent and requires less than about 25×106 dynes/cm2 for an elongation of 20 percent as tested per ASTM Standard D-882.
